The Manager, Pharmacy Distribution Operations is responsible for overseeing specific areas of pharmacy services, programs, and personnel and is responsible for provision of all facets of pharmaceutical care related to patients/consumers of the pharmacy services.

How you will make an impact:

  • Ensures safe, timely, efficient, compliant, and productive workflows in the operational and service areas in their areas of oversight and may be responsible for the direct supervision of any combination of pharmacy technicians, pharmacy learners, pharmacists, or support staff who work within their scope of responsibility.
  • Project management, oversight and involvement will range from independent work on small projects, to leading teams on large scale changes.
  • Projects may involve departments external to pharmacy and the Pharmacy Manager will work with other teams/departments to ensure that the activities and contributions align with priorities and timelines for the organization.
  • Collaborates with the pharmacy leadership team, including the Director of Pharmacy and the Staff Vice President of Pharmacy Operations.
  • Oversee daily fulfillment and PV2 operations.
  • Supervise and lead the provision of safe, timely, efficient, equitable, effective, and patient-centered pharmacy distribution services.
  • Hold staff accountable to standards of the department.
  • Responsible for understanding, compliance, and participation in Quality Assurance, Performance Improvement, and accreditation guidelines ensuring achievement of excellence in quality patient care.  
  • Serve as the liaison to coordinate compliance and regulatory issues for areas of responsibility.  
  • Support fulfillment technician workflows to drive quality, efficiency, and productivity.
  • Support PV2 clinical pharmacy workflows and practice expectations through operational planning.
  • Develop and/or maintain policies and procedures for pharmacy fulfillment and distribution in collaboration with the pharmacy leadership team.  
  • Identify opportunities to redesign systems of oversight to maximize performance (i.e.: labor and operational efficiency).  
  • Review reports and records for medication errors, adverse drug events, and/or ineffective service, taking appropriate corrective action.  
  • Participate in department’s strategic plan development and execution of assigned goals.
  • Identify and develop business cases for operational services based upon anticipated future needs, operational advancement, and organizational priorities.
  • Participate and/or lead, as pharmacy representative, organization quality improvement initiatives/projects.
  • Serve as a pharmacy team liaison to interdisciplinary team members for areas of responsibility.  
  • Select, train, develop and motivate a competent staff to meet and surpass goals and objectives.

Minimum Requirements:

  • Requires an RPh and a minimum of 3 years pharmacy experience and a minimum of 3 years management experience; or any combination of education and experience, which would provide an equivalent background.
  • Current active unrestricted state license to practice pharmacy as a Registered Pharmacist (RPh) in applicable state(s) required.

Preferred Skills, Capabilities, and Experiences:

  • PharmD preferred.
  • Certified Specialty Pharmacist (CSP) credential achieved or willing to obtain within 1 year of employment strongly preferred.
  • Prior experience with specialty pharmacy fulfillment and dispensing operations strongly preferred.
  • Prior experience with mail order and/or retail pharmacy compliance.
  • Knowledge of DEA, FDA and state regulations preferred.
  • Experience interpreting compliance requirements and regulations preferred.
  • Experience working with State Boards of Pharmacy regarding complaints, issue resolution, inspection and central fill requirements preferred.
